For the Love of God, Stop Letting Elon Musk Near Public Transit!

Elon Musk’s The Boring Company has been tasked with providing a “mass transit” system to serve Las Vegas, and now Fort Lauderdale. The result is a bunch of Tesla cabs in tunnels. But is this idea actually as dumb as it sounds, or is Elon Musk as much of a genius as he thinks he is? (It’s dumb).

